The agent of Heerenveen striker Alfred Finnbogason has admitted that, from his point of view, his priority is to move his client to a club in either England or Germany.

Finnbogason has been linked with a number of Premier League sides, including Newcastle, Everton and Aston Villa.

 


The striker, who recently rejected a proposal from Heerenveen to extend his current contract, which is due to expire in 2015, is also wanted by Russian Premier League giants Zenit St. Petersburg.

And with every new club to show an interest, the chances of Finnbogason remaining in Holland for too much longer shrink.

But for the striker's agent, some countries are more appealing than others.

"We have interesting offers from Italy, England, Germany and Russia", Magnus Magnusson Heghnar explained to Izvestia.

"While I am not ready to disclose the names of these clubs, the interest from all is very serious.

"For me it was not unexpected. Alfred does his job well, scoring goals in every match in the Dutch league.

"His contract with Heerenveen is valid until 2015, but it is possible he will leave the team in the winter.

"For me, the priority is to move to England or Germany, but the choice is entirely up to Alfred."
